- Yogurt
What comes to mind first when you think of probiotics? Yogurt is one of the most famous probiotic known today. When it comes to choosing yogurt look for the phrase “live active cultures” to ensure you are consuming probiotics. Stay away from yogurts with more than 15 grams of sugar because sugar will feed the bad bacteria in your gut. Making the probiotics not as effective.
Probiotic is also known as the “friendly bacteria.” These bacteria live in your gut. Enhancing the microbiome of your gut. This is shown to improve body’s immune system, help with constipation, enhance gastrointestinal track, and much more.
